Description
It was built because the old bridge was too small and got flooded by trucks and cars and couldn't cross by it smoothly and it causes traffic as it is a narrow bridge. The bridge was built to improve not only traffic but also for safety during heavy rains when the first would would usually flood and couldn't be used.
Original Position
Original bridge or old bridge was built in the 1930 and opened to the public in 1931 and has been in operation for 82 years

Inscriptions
/Warrenton Bridge on National Route N18. The low level bridge was built in the 1930 and opened to the public on the 29 October 1931. The office of the chief inspector of roads of the Cape Provincial Administration was responsible for the design. The construction works were taken up by Mr. Marshall. The low level bridge had been in operation for 82 years. The South African National Roads Agency SOC Limited (SANRAL) decided to improve the freeboard height during high floods of the Vaal river and to also enhance the overall traffic flow and safety on National Rout N18 by constructing the 36m, 16-span bridge next to the low level bridge. Construction commenced in July 2011 and was completed in September 2012. The bridge was designed by SANRAL and constructed by the CIVILCON-PELE KAOFELA JOINT VENTURE and supervised by SNA Civil and structural engineers (PTY)LDT./
